    Durapost Warranty

    DuraPost Guarantee

    The DuraPost Guarantee gives you the peace of mind that the DuraPost fence post is guaranteed against structural failure due to corrosion for up to 25 years subject to normal maintenance and proper use.

    Claiming

    In the event of product structural failure due to corrosion, the product will be replaced free of charge provided that:

    • None of the exclusions apply;
    • You are able to provide evidence of the structural failure at a location related to a previously registered guarantee; structural failure is defined as the DuraPost fence post cracking due to corrosion resulting in the fence falling over;
    • No alterations have been made to the product;
    • The guarantee is registered on the DuraPost® website correctly with all details correctly submitted;

    Autumn and Winter Fencing needs

    Garden Fencing all year round

    The latest "Beast from the East" due in late November 2022 may be averted but wet weather and high winds are a feature of the British climate.  Constant heavy rain followed by high winds will soften the ground and posts become loose - a fatal combination for the garden fence.  It is worth considering your current fencing and whether you will repair or replace your existing fencing style.  

    Repair or Replace?

    Whatever fence styles you may have you will need to check your existing fence posts, are they loose and is there any rotting just below ground level?  If some posts are rotten then you can use repair spurs or add extra intermediate posts on a featheredge fence run.     Featheredge

    Featheredge boards and lengths

    Without going into too much detail we thought we would answer some typical issues with featheredge boards, or are they featheredge slats?  To add to the confusion they are also known as closeboarding. Featheredge is a traditional board commonly used in agricultural buildings.  Normal-sized lengths are:

    125mm width at 1.2m, 1.65m and 1.8 metres;

    150mm width at 1.05m, 1.2m, 1.65m, 1.8m, 2.4m, 3.0m and 3.6 metres;

    175mm width at 4.8 metres.

     

    What overlap for the boards?

    We keep in stock 125mm, 1S0mm and 175mm sawn featheredge boards.  The 125mm are intended to be used in fencing applications, the 150mm are available 2.4m/3.0m and 3.6 metre lengths making them more suitable for cladding garden sheds, workshops, field shelets and other similar outdoor buildings. Our 175mm featheredge is cut from thicker blanks and normally available in 4.8 metre lengths.

    DuraPost fencing system

    The DuraPost fencing system was introduced to combine the best qualities of traditional timber and concrete posts. Made in the UK from galvanised steel the DuraPost Gate Post features a choice of colours. Furthermore if installed carefully should be maintenance free.

    Why use DuraPost?

    By using powder coated metals in the construction there are several benefits – lower weight, colour options, low maintenance and durability. Most products are available in plain galvanised, anthracite grey, olive grey and sienna brown. DuraPost is made in the UK from cold-rolled galvanised steel. The post is designed to face the worst weather without warping or cracking and is guaranteed for up to 25 years. The unique design has been tested and proven to be able to withstand winds up to 110mph. The DuraPost Corner Post is a durable lightweight bit of kit, designed to be carried and fitted by one person.
